CVE-2019-8811 Explained : Impact and Mitigation

Learn about CVE-2019-8811 addressing memory corruption issues in iOS, iPadOS, tvOS, watchOS, Safari, iTunes for Windows, and iCloud for Windows, potentially leading to arbitrary code execution.

Enhancements were made to memory management to resolve various memory corruption problems in multiple Apple products. The issues have been addressed in iOS 13.2 and iPadOS 13.2, tvOS 13.2, watchOS 6.1, Safari 13.0.3, iTunes for Windows 12.10.2, iCloud for Windows 11.0, and iCloud for Windows 7.15. The vulnerability could allow the execution of arbitrary code through the processing of maliciously crafted web content.

Vulnerability Description

Enhancements in memory management were implemented to rectify memory corruption problems in the affected Apple products, preventing potential exploitation.

Affected Systems and Versions

        iOS and iPadOS versions less than 13.2
        tvOS versions less than 13.2
        watchOS versions less than 6.1
        Safari versions less than 13.0.3
        iTunes for Windows versions less than 12.10.2
        iCloud for Windows versions less than 11.0 and 7.15

Exploitation Mechanism

The vulnerability can be exploited through the processing of maliciously crafted web content, potentially allowing threat actors to execute arbitrary code on the affected systems.
